| CVE-2025-62511 | 1 Ytgrabber-tui | 1 Ytgrabber-tui | 2026-04-15 | 6.3 Medium |
| yt-grabber-tui is a C++ terminal user interface application for downloading YouTube content. yt-grabber-tui version 1.0 contains a Time-of-Check to Time-of-Use (TOCTOU) race condition (CWE-367) in the creation of the default configuration file config.json. In version 1.0, load_json_settings in Settings.hpp checks for the existence of config.json using boost::filesystem::exists and, if the file is missing, calls create_json_settings which writes the JSON configuration with boost::property_tree::write_json. A local attacker with write access to the application’s configuration directory (~/.config/yt-grabber-tui on Linux or the current working directory on Windows) can create a symbolic link between the existence check and the subsequent write so that the write operation follows the symlink and overwrites an attacker-chosen file accessible to the running process. This enables arbitrary file overwrite within the privileges of the application process, which can corrupt files and cause loss of application or user data. If the application is executed with elevated privileges, this could extend to system file corruption. The issue is fixed in version 1.0.1. | ||||

| CVE-2024-50592 | 1 Hasomed | 1 Elefant Software Updater | 2026-04-15 | 7 High |
| An attacker with local access the to medical office computer can escalate his Windows user privileges to "NT AUTHORITY\SYSTEM" by exploiting a race condition in the Elefant Update Service during the repair or update process. When using the repair function, the service queries the server for a list of files and their hashes. In addition, instructions to execute binaries to finalize the repair process are included. The executables are executed as "NT AUTHORITY\SYSTEM" after they are copied over to the user writable installation folder (C:\Elefant1). This means that a user can overwrite either "PostESUUpdate.exe" or "Update_OpenJava.exe" in the time frame after the copy and before the execution of the final repair step. The overwritten executable is then executed as "NT AUTHORITY\SYSTEM". | ||||

| CVE-2025-32784 | 2026-04-15 | N/A | ||
| conda-forge-webservices is the web app deployed to run conda-forge admin commands and linting. In versions prior to 2025.4.10, a race condition vulnerability has been identified in the conda-forge-webservices component used within the shared build infrastructure. This vulnerability, categorized as a Time-of-Check to Time-of-Use (TOCTOU) issue, can be exploited to introduce unauthorized modifications to build artifacts stored in the cf-staging Anaconda channel. Exploitation may result in the unauthorized publication of malicious artifacts to the production conda-forge channel. The core vulnerability results from the absence of atomicity between the hash validation and the artifact copy operation. This gap allows an attacker, with access to the cf-staging token, to overwrite the validated artifact with a malicious version immediately after hash verification, but before the copy action is executed. As the cf-staging channel permits artifact overwrites, such an operation can be carried out using the anaconda upload --force command. This vulnerability is fixed in 2025.4.10. | ||||
